I had a web page that worked fine. Then I added a table. The table displayed fine in Dreamweaver Design mode, but in Live mode the cell spacing was missing. Also horizontal rules did not display. The same display problems existed in a browser. I slowly deleted parts of my page and while I found that deleting the dropdown menu did not solve the problem, deleting the three lines of code needed for bootstrap implementation of dropdown menu did solve the cell spacing and horizontal rule problem. The lines deleted from the "head" were: <link rel="stylesheet" href="https://maxcdn.bootstrapcdn.com/bootstrap/3.4.1/css/bootstrap.min.css"><script src="https://ajax.googleapis.com/ajax/libs/jquery/3.5.1/jquery.min.js"></script><script src="https://maxcdn.bootstrapcdn.com/bootstrap/3.4.1/js/bootstrap.min.js"></script> This is the first time I had used bootstrap.
